    Abstract: A laser device is provided for performing an annular circumferential welding on a workpiece, and includes a laser head having a laser source configured for emitting a laser beam to perform welding around an outer circumferential target area of the workpiece. Also included is an optical reflector assembly having at least two optical reflectors spaced from the workpiece for reflecting the laser beam emitted from the laser head. The reflectors are spaced from each other, disposed on opposite lateral sides of the workpiece, and inclined relative to an axis transverse to a longitudinal axis of the workpiece so that the circumferential weld is achieved by a single cycle of the laser beam.

    Abstract: A dialysis bag is provided, including a first layer of film and a second layer of film each having a closed end and an opposite outlet end, the layers sealed together about corresponding peripheral edges to define a bag chamber. An outlet assembly is sealingly disposed at the corresponding outlet ends and has a tubular administrative outlet with an inlet and is in fluid communication with the bag chamber. A dimple is formed in at least one of the layers adjacent to the inlet for preventing occlusion as a fluid level decreases in the bag.

    Abstract: A port assembly includes a housing with an opening and a bore therethrough, a slit septum disposed in the bore to control access through the opening, a base joined to the housing and having a membrane attached thereto, a perforator having a first end abutting the slit septum and a second end aligned with the membrane, and a resilient member disposed between the perforator and the base. The port assembly may be used in a fluid container that includes a receptacle for retaining a fluid, and at least one conduit in communication with the receptacle. The at least one conduit may be defined, at least in part, by the port assembly.

    Abstract: A needleless connector includes a housing having an inlet and an outlet, a valve disposed in the housing to control flow between the inlet and the outlet, and a gland disposed in the housing between the inlet and the outlet. The gland has a deformable wall defining a space, and at least one reinforcement attached to the deformable wall within the space.

    Abstract: A valve assembly for permitting fluid flow in a first direction and for preventing fluid flow in a second direction opposite to the first direction. The valve assembly includes an upper housing, a lower housing coupled to the upper housing to form a generally axially extending housing assembly, and a valve seating section defined within an inner peripheral portion of the lower housing. The valve seating section includes an axially extending inner peripheral surface and a transversely extending surface substantially normal to the axially extending inner peripheral surface. A valve member is seated within the valve seating section of said lower housing. The valve member includes a flange that extends from the valve member in a transverse direction and defines an axially oriented outer peripheral surface thereof.

    Abstract: A flow adjusting tube clamp is used with a chamber in a solution administration device. The tube clamp is pivotally mounted to the cap at a second pivot element. The tube clamp includes first and second elongated tube passages that overly the cap inlet ports as the clamp is pivoted. The tube passages define varying cross-sectional open areas therethrough. The passages are arcuate so that they continuously overly the inlet ports as the clamp is pivoted. The inlet ports are configured to receive flexible tube portions that traverse through the tube passages in the clamp. Each tube passage includes at least one open area and at least one occluding portion to establish and terminate flow therethrough. The clamp is pivotable from a prime position to an intermittent flow position and from an intermittent flow position to a continuous flow position, to effect varying flow conditions.
